Read moreColored profile pictures, often abbreviated as colored PFPs, have become a popular way for online communities to express individuality and unity, especially during moot ups—virtual gatherings or events where users show off themed profile pictures. Moot ups foster a sense of community and can go viral across social media platforms, encouraging users to participate by updating their avatars to match the event's theme. The hashtag #coloredpfp highlights this growing trend where users customize their profile images with vivid colors, unique designs, or overlays, making their profiles visually striking.
